Fire Services employee attempts self-immolation in Odisha's Kendujhar, alleges harassment
India, Sept. 12 -- A Fire Services employee reportedly attempted self-immolation to end his life at office in Anandapur in Kendujhar district, citing mental stress and alleged harassment by a senior officer.
The incident reportedly occurred at the three-storey Shalapada Fire Services office, where employee Hemananda Dehuri climbed onto the rooftop and threatened to take the extreme step.
According to the allegations, Dehuri has been facing repeated mental pressure and harassment from officer Surya Hembram. Other employees present at the office intervened and safely brought him down from the rooftop.
